+/// Issue a standard HttpRequest::requestPut() call but using
+/// and LLSD object as the request body. Conventions are the
+/// same as with that method. Caller is expected to provide
+/// an HttpHeaders object with a correct 'Content-Type:' header.
+/// One will not be provided by this call.
+///
+/// @return If request is successfully issued, the
+/// HttpHandle representing the request.
+/// On error, LLCORE_HTTP_HANDLE_INVALID
+/// is returned and caller can fetch detailed
+/// status with the getStatus() method on the
+/// request object. In case of error, no
+/// request is queued and caller may need to
+/// perform additional cleanup such as freeing
+/// a now-useless HttpHandler object.
+///
+LLCore::HttpHandle requestPutWithLLSD(LLCore::HttpRequest * request,
+ LLCore::HttpRequest::policy_t policy_id,
+ LLCore::HttpRequest::priority_t priority,
+ const std::string & url,
+ const LLSD & body,
+ LLCore::HttpOptions * options,
+ LLCore::HttpHeaders * headers,
+ LLCore::HttpHandler * handler);
+

+//========================================================================
+LLHttpSDHandler::LLHttpSDHandler(const LLURI &uri):
+ mUri(uri)
+{
+
+}
+
+void LLHttpSDHandler::onCompleted(LLCore::HttpHandle handle, LLCore::HttpResponse * response)
+{
+ LLCore::HttpStatus status = response->getStatus();
+
+ if (!status)
+ {
+ this->onFailure(response, status);
+ }
+ else
+ {
+ LLSD resplsd;
+ const bool emit_parse_errors = false;
+
+ bool parsed = !((response->getBodySize() == 0) ||
+ !LLCoreHttpUtil::responseToLLSD(response, emit_parse_errors, resplsd));
+
+ if (!parsed)
+ {
+ // Only emit a warning if we failed to parse when 'content-type' == 'application/llsd+xml'
+ LLCore::HttpHeaders::ptr_t headers(response->getHeaders());
+ const std::string *contentType = (headers) ? headers->find(HTTP_IN_HEADER_CONTENT_TYPE) : NULL;
+
+ if (contentType && (HTTP_CONTENT_LLSD_XML == *contentType))
+ {
+ std::string thebody = LLCoreHttpUtil::responseToString(response);
+
+ LL_WARNS() << "Failed to deserialize . " << getUri() << " [status:" << response->getStatus().toString() << "] "
+ << " body: " << thebody << LL_ENDL;
+ }
+ }
+
+ this->onSuccess(response, resplsd);
+ }
+
+ // The handler must destroy itself when it is done.
+ delete this;
+}
+
